The Significance of Illinois ID Holograms

Illinois, a state known for its commitment to innovation, has adopted holographic technology to enhance the security of its identification documents. Holograms are three-dimensional images created through the interference of light waves. These images possess unique optical properties that make them nearly impossible to replicate accurately with conventional printing techniques.

Key Features of Illinois ID Holograms

  1. Visual Complexity: Illinois ID holograms are designed with intricate patterns, multiple layers, and a fusion of colors. These complex visuals are challenging to recreate, even with advanced printing technology.

  2. Dynamic Effects: Holograms exhibit dynamic effects when viewed from different angles. This property adds an extra layer of complexity, making it extremely difficult for counterfeiters to mimic the shifting visuals accurately.

  3. Tamper-Evident: Attempting to tamper with a hologram often results in visible damage. If the hologram is peeled off or manipulated, it leaves behind evident signs of interference, thus serving as a tamper-evident feature.

  4. Microtext and Fine Details: Embedded within the hologram are microscopic texts and intricate details that are virtually impossible to replicate using standard printing methods.

  5. Multi-Layered Security: Illinois ID holograms often incorporate multiple layers of security features, combining holography with other advanced techniques like ultraviolet (UV) ink, laser engraving, and guilloché patterns.

The Production Process

The creation of Illinois ID holograms is a multi-step process that requires precision, expertise, and cutting-edge technology. Here is an overview of the production process:

  1. Master Origination: Skilled designers create a digital master hologram template using specialized software. This template serves as the basis for generating the holographic image.

  2. Exposure and Embossing: The master template is transferred to a photosensitive material through exposure to laser light. This process, known as embossing, recreates the intricate holographic pattern on the material.

  3. Metallization: The embossed material is then coated with a thin layer of metal, usually aluminum. This layer adds reflective properties to the hologram, enabling it to exhibit dynamic effects.

  4. Adhesive Application: An adhesive layer is applied to the metallized material, allowing it to be affixed to the ID card during the final production stage.

  5. Integration with Other Security Features: The hologram is often combined with other security elements, such as UV ink printing, laser engraving, and microtext, to create a multi-layered security solution.

Enhancing Security and Preventing Counterfeiting

The primary purpose of Illinois ID holograms is to enhance security and prevent counterfeiting. These holograms play a crucial role in safeguarding against fraudulent activities such as identity theft, illegal immigration, and financial crimes. The unique combination of visual complexity, dynamic effects, and tamper-evident properties makes holograms an effective deterrent against counterfeiters.

Benefits Beyond Security

While security remains the primary focus, Illinois ID holograms offer additional benefits:

  1. Ease of Verification: Law enforcement officers, bouncers, and other individuals responsible for verifying identification can quickly authenticate a genuine ID by inspecting its hologram.

  2. Public Trust and Confidence: The presence of a hologram instills confidence in the authenticity of the ID document, fostering trust between citizens and government institutions.

  3. Modernization and Innovation: The adoption of holographic technology demonstrates the state's commitment to staying at the forefront of technological advancements.
